Q. With national competitive bidding delayed, how do I help my association continue to fight for our industry? A. Our industry has won a major battle, no doubt about it. But the question that must be answered (not just asked) is what now? State associations and their members must continue to take leadership roles in helping to solve the healthcare crisis that our nation faces. The next few months are critical-we must hold their attention-so start today. As part of the solution, state associations and their members need to work with legislators who champion our industry. Many state associations and their members have already contacted legislators, asking to be a part of the process. We need to provide them with information on what it takes to provide the quality products, services, maintenance and education involved in being an integral part of the solution. State associations and their members must also find ways to help root out the criminals whose fraudulent activities continue to bloody the nose of an industry filled with ethical, caring and dedicated healthcare and business professionals. In addition to legislators, state associations and their members must also carry this campaign to the media. We need to show all who will listen our level of integrity and dedication to providing for the people who need our products and services so desperately. So, what now, you ask? Take a deep breath, give yourself a pat on the back, join your state association and get to work being a part of this solution. We can never let our industry be put into this predicament again. We must act now.
